  • Strategic Sourcing - Clinical Protective Apparel

    >Worked on the sourcing activity underpinned by procurement best practices to setup contract (7 years duration) for Clinical Protective Apparel for HealthShare

    >Introduced multiple processes in open tender process like industry forums, supplier feedback sessions to actively engage market

    >Extracted best value for taxpayer’s money through initiatives like state-wide volume based discounts and consolidating 3 contracts into a single contract to leverage on synergies with common suppliers

    >Managed tough and challenging stakeholders from 17 Local Health Districts to influence positive outcomes the led to a successful project

    >Built and presented financial model to evaluate the qualitative and quantitative aspects of the tender to executive team led by the CPO of HealthShare

    >New contract yielded direct cost savings of 10.4% (~$18 Mn) with potential for further 9.1% (~$34 Mn) savings depending on product selection at LHDs

    >Designed Category Management Plan for HealthShare to manage the category, contracts and suppliers through quality data management and supplier engagement

    >Received individual and team awards at NSWP staff meetings for my contributions to the project

  • Nano-second flash technology

    This technology served as a flagship product in a disruptive space defending Applied Material's reputation to innovate and deliver future inflection technologies. Traditional 2-D transistors could no longer be scaled and Moore's law has reached its limits. This tool caters to the un-served market of 3-D transistors which would change the dynamics of industry in the coming 3-5 years.
    -->I was assigned the critical laser module design which include packaging the lasers and the complex array of optics.
    -->Leading a team of 3 members, i was responsible from concept level design to the customer shipment of the module
    -->Learnt a lot about Opto-Mechanical design for this project and completed the module design in 6 months getting the buy-in from all key stake holders
    -->Single point of contact between cross-functional teams like Software, Electrical, Packaging (internally) and Customer Engineers, Suppliers (Externally) to ensure that project was on track
    -->Delivered 4 tools to tier-1 customers and won the Team of the Quarter for our contribution
